3CX v14 with Yealink T42 and T46 handsets

Basically what my customer requires is that anybody in the office can
a) see if there is a message waiting on extension 101 and
b) listen to it easily, preferably using the programmable keys.

All extensions have personal voicemail but the main office number goes to voicemail on extension 101 if unanswered, which anybody should be able to access.

I see that this has been raised several times as a feature request, but does anyone know a good workaround? Preferably on the handset and not using group email etc.

Thank you!
 
I think that the most "reasonable" work-around, for this, if you are using sets with a spare line key, is to have that extension appear on each phone. The problem may be in having the MWI work with more than one extension (key) per set.

The only other solution might be (and this would work if all users were in the same room) is to have extension 101 connected to an ATA which in turn is connected to a (large) MWI lamp, visible to all. they would still have to dial 999 (pause) # (pause) 101, to reach the voicemail.

VoIP sets normally don't allow pauses, or a change to DTMF signalling, on a speed-call key, so that, unfortunately, won't work.
